Right here are the key differences between a Master Plumbing Technician and a Journeyman: Highest degree of proficiency in plumbing. Requires extensive training, experience, and passing a licensing examination. Licensed to run a plumbing service, pull licenses, and monitor other plumbing technicians. Skilled in complex installments, repairs, and managing projects. Mid-level plumbing expertise, in between apprentice and master.


Functions under the guidance of master plumbing professionals. Knowledgeable in fundamental pipes tasks, installations, and repair services yet doesn't look after jobs individually. Ending up being a master plumbing technician typically involves years of dedication and experience. The journey begins with an instruction that lasts around 4 to five years, during which hopeful plumbers learn the fundamentals of the profession with a combination of classroom research and hands-on work under the support of seasoned specialists.

The period as a journeyman can differ, yet it usually ranges from 2 to 5 years, depending on the certain requirements set by the state or licensing authority. As soon as the essential functional experience is built up, aiming master plumbings have to pass a licensing examination. H&A clog cleaning plumber queens ny. In general, the timeline to become a master plumbing professional can span around 8 to 10 years or more, including apprenticeship, journeyman work, and the licensure procedure
